두만강 유역의 합리적인 수자원 개발방안 도출을 위한 2인 비영합 협력게임 적용 (Application of the cooperative two-person nonzero-sum game for water resources development in the Tumen river basin)

  • This study aims to make a decision about the rational option for a multipurpose dams development of the Tumen river basin so that the adjoining countries will effectively deal with the chronic problems and fully satisfy the fast growing demand of water and power. It has been thus far investigated that the interests between North Korea and China closely depend on the selected option, and they are not well compatible with each other. These situations are defined in terms of the cooperative two-person nonzero-sum game. The Nash bargaining model is then applied to contemplate the rational option, considering two scenarios of economic growth of the North Korea. After analyzing the model, it was expected that 1) two multipurpose dams must be cooperatively developed, and 2) their benefits should be allocated according to demand of each country. The authors finally suggest that a cooperative organisation be established to effectively manage the dams beyond the border of the countries.

Log-Average-SNR Ratio and Cooperative Spectrum Sensing

  • In this paper, we analyze the spectrum-sensing performance of a cooperative cognitive radio (CR) network consisting of a number of CR nodes and a fusion center (FC). We introduce the "log-average-SNR ratio" that relates the average SNR of the CR-node-FC link and that of the primary-user-CR-node link. Assuming that the FC utilizes the K-out-of-N rule as its decision rule, we derive exact expressions for the sensing gain and the coding gain - parameters used to characterize the CR network performance at the high SNR region. Based on these results, we determine ways to optimize the performance of the CR network.

부산공동어시장의 배당정책 (The Dividend Policy of the Pusan Cooperative Fish Market)

  • Dividend Policy involves the decision to pay out earnings versus retaining them for reinvestment in the firm, and dividend policy decisions can have either favorable or unfavorable effects on the attainment of firm's objective. This paper is to examine the present status of dividend policy of the Pusan Cooperative Fish Market, and to suggest the optimal dividend policy decisions appropriate for achieving its objective, which is to promote the fishermen's benefits and protect the interest of consumers. There are two types of dividend that the Pusan Cooperative Fish Market pays to the equity owners : (1) dividend on capital and (2) equalized patronage dividend. During'90s, while the rate of dividend on capital ranged from 1.7% to 2.8%, that of equalized patronage dividend ranged from 13.9% to 22.9%. Therefore, the rate of total dividend on capital including revolving funds has been about 20%, which turns out to be much higher than those of companies listed in the stock market. According to the current dividend data, the Pusan Cooperative Fish Market focuses on the equalized patronage dividend and the dividen on capital is the secondary type of dividend. In addition, the interesting feature of equalized patronage dividend is that it is supposed to be reinvested into capital by the Articles of the Fish Market, as soon as the Fish Market pays it to its members. Finally, this paper suggests the rational dividend policy of the Fish Market that is able to help its objective to be achidved more efficiently. The overall direction of the rational dividend policy can be summarized as follows ; (1) The level of cash dividend on capital should be increased enough to reflect the market interest rate. (2) The subsidy of working capital to some member fisheries cooperatives as quasi- dividend should be cut off steadily. (3) The equalized patronage dividend should be replaced by the original patronage dividend whose level is determined by the volume of each member's purchase. (4) In the long-term, it is necessary to improve the system of revolving funds in the way that revoloving funds could serve to complement equity capital for only a fixed time, after which they ard repaid to the members.

Cooperative control system of the floating cranes for the dual lifting

  • This paper proposes a dual lifting and its cooperative control system with two different kinds of floating cranes. The Mega-erection and Giga-erection in the ship building are used to handle heavier and wider blocks and modules as ships and off-shore platforms are enlarged. However, there is no equipment to handle such Tera-blocks. In order to overcome the limit on performance of existing floating cranes, the dual lifting is proposed in this research. In the dual lifting, two floating cranes are well-coordinated to add up the lift capabilities of both cranes without any loss such that virtually a single crane is lifting, maneuvering and unloading. Two main constraints for the dual lifting are as follows: First, two barges of floating cranes should be constrained as a rigid body not to cause a relative motion between two barges and main hooks of the two cranes should be controlled as main hooks of a single crane. In order words, it is necessary to develop the cooperative control of two floating cranes in order to sustain a center of gravity of the module and minimize the tilting angle during the lifting and unloading by the two floating cranes. Two floating cranes are handled as a master-slave system. The master crane is able to gather information about all working conditions and make a decision to control the individual hook speed, which communicates the slave crane by TCP/IP. The developed control system has been embedded in the real floating crane systems and the dual lifting has been demonstrated five times at SHI shipyard in 2015. The moving angles of the lifting module are analyzed and verified to be suitable for hoisting control. It is verified that the dual lifting can be applied for many heavier and wider blocks and modules to shorten the construction time of ships and off-shore platforms.
